Latest Patents
Kuznetsov holds a patent titled "Updating configuration information to a perimeter network." This invention focuses on the automatic transmission of configuration information from a trusted network to a perimeter network. The patent describes a system where master servers in the trusted network manage a distributed directory service containing configuration information. Edge servers in the perimeter network utilize a local directory service specific to each server. Additionally, edge-connected bridgehead servers in the trusted network replicate configuration information to the perimeter network. The process includes trusted servers acquiring leases on edge servers to facilitate this replication.
